Amniotic fluid embolism

Clin Obstet Gynecol. 1996 Mar;39(1):101-6. doi: 10.1097/00003081-199603000-00010.

Abstract

AFE, although rare, remains a significant cause of maternal mortality. Even with improvements in supportive care, the prognosis remains poor for mother and fetus. The guidelines presented may help the physician to recognize this condition when it occurs and give some direction for therapy.
